On my old Pismo with OS 9.2.1 I could open a fairly complex .AI file (created from a .DWG CAD drawing) in Freehand 9 by asigning around 100MB to the app, the Mac had 384MB of RAM.
But now on my PB 15" 768MB RAM and OS X.3.3 and Frrehand MX the file cannot be opened due to "not enough memory".
What ?!
Any ideas ? I cannot accept that this spec Mac cannot do the job that an old G3 with half the memory could...
I'd suspect a messed up file rather than the error you're getting. I've seen the 'Not enough memory' errors with corrupted PDF and Photoshop files.
